Caracol, Lomanai (both in present day Belize) and Tikal (in Guatemala) are among the many remnaining sites of the once extensive Mayan culture consisting of city states scattered across Mesoamerica. These excavated ruins are but a small sample of these once highly populated sites (evidence suggests that Lomanai for example has over 30,000 structures in the surrounding area). Decoding of the few surviving Mayan Codex has allowed a glimpse into the history of this advanced society and it's sudden demise. Current thought includes contributary causes such as warfare and ecological devastation brought on by overuse of resources. Possibly a harbinger of our own future.
